Overview

A Dispute Board is involved with the project or venture from inception through to completion and has ‘hands on’ knowledge of every aspect of the process. The Dispute Board knows the parties, knows their goals and objectives, and can act efficiently to prevent a dispute from arising or, if one does, to give a decision in some cases.
